The phrase
"court application" refers to the formal process of asking a court to make a decision or order regarding a legal matter, such as a dispute or a request for justice. It involves submitting a written document to the court outlining the facts, arguments, and desired outcome, and then waiting for the court to consider and decide on the matter.
